По структири html нет йолочки, а по css код неудобочитаемый лутше его пописывать по горизоттали типа:                 .head {width: 1004px; height: 133px; position: relative;} 			.sun {position: absolute; left: 275px;} 			.language {position: absolute; right: 37px; bottom: 3px;} 			.language a {display: block; padding: 1px 27px 0 9px; font-size: 10px; text-transform: uppercase; color: #fff; float: left;} 			.language .rus {background: url(../images/rus.png) right top no-repeat;} 			.language .eng {background: url(../images/eng.png) right top no-repeat;} 			.language .activ {color: #b8e4ff;}